Birds of Prey #52
“Reunions”
In "Reunions," Birds of Prey confronts a mysterious energy entity tied to Simon Stagg, as Canary and Metamorpho clash with its volatile power. Meanwhile, Barbara faces off against Danko Twag in a tense, unpredictable encounter that takes a dark turn. Written by Gilbert Hernandez and illustrated by Casey Jones, with colors by Hi-Fi and letters by John E. Workman Jr., this 2003 issue features a striking cover by Phil Noto.

Full plot ⚠ may contain spoilers
▸ Reveal full plot — may contain spoilers
Canary and Metamorpho try to defeat the energy being controlled by Simon Stagg. Barbara fights off Danko Twag, who appears to commit suicide.
